Mesothelioma Lawyers

A mesothelioma attorney can help families or individuals make a claim for compensation. The best firm will have a lot of knowledge of asbestos litigation.

They will have a demonstrated history of securing significant settlements and jury verdicts for clients. They will also have a deep understanding of federal and state laws regarding asbestos regulations.

Experience

A good mesothelioma lawyer has extensive experience representing asbestos victims. They will be familiar with the details of mesothelioma laws across the nation, including unique regulations, statutes of limitations and compensation levels. These lawyers should also understand the difficulties faced by victims and their families following an mesothelioma diagnosis.

Mesothelioma attorneys should have a proven track of success in obtaining large settlements and verdicts on behalf of their clients. They should also have an extensive network of experts and specialists that can provide the scientific, medical, and economic evidence required to support their clients their claims.

Additionally the attorney representing mesothelioma must be aware of the asbestos trust funds and how they work. These funds allow patients with mesothelioma receive compensation for their medical costs and other financial expenses associated with the treatment.

Many victims may not be aware that they can recover compensation from asbestos trust funds. An asbestos lawyer will be able explain the benefits of trust fund and help victims determine their eligibility.

Mesothelioma lawsuits are time-sensitive. They must be filed within a certain time frame otherwise the patient could lose the right sue. This is why it's crucial to choose mesothelioma attorneys who have experience with the complex legal process and knows how to file cases on time.

Fees

The financial burdens that come with mesothelioma are often heavy.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ist families obtain compensation for medical expenses, funeral expenses and lost income. Mesothelioma patients may be entitled to additional compensation, including for pain and suffering as well as loss of consortium. A mesothelioma lawyer is also able to assist in filing VA benefits and asbestos trust fund claims.

Many mesothelioma lawyers provide free case evaluations. In these meetings, lawyers can examine the merits and value of your case and determine the amount of compensation you should receive. They usually work on a contingency basis, which means they only get paid if you are compensated.

Additionally to that, a mesothelioma law company that has handled a variety of cases might be better able to handle the complexities that could arise in lawsuits. For instance, those who have been exposed to asbestos on military sites typically have multiple claims involving both the Department of Veteran Affairs and the companies that produced the asbestos-laden products they worked with. A reputable company will know how to deal with these different sources of compensation and how to combine them to get the best results.

An experienced mesothelioma law Firm has a team of professionals that can gather evidence and asbestos documents such as medical bills, employment history and other information to identify the source of asbestos exposure. They will also conduct interviews with witnesses and coworkers to discover more about the source of asbestos exposure. The firm may even be able to locate records from the asbestos company that might not be in other archives.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is of high excellent quality should be able to bring lawsuits in state and federal court. Depending on the state the statute of limitation for filing claims may differ. It is important to act as quickly as possible to make sure you don't miss your chance to receive compensation.

Some lawyers also have a team of appellate lawyers who handle appeals when a decision of the lower court is challenged. Your mesothelioma attorney should clarify whether they are willing to take on this obligation and how it would perform if required.

Location

The top mesothelioma lawyers across the country are located in New York, where several experienced asbestos law firms have offices. These firms have handled thousands cases and secured millions of dollars for their clients. Many of these settlements came from asbestos trust funds, which pay those who are not able to sue companies for injuries. An asbestos lawyer will determine the type of legal claim that is appropriate for the individual victim based on their exposure history.

The types of compensation offered in mesothelioma lawsuits differ widely based on the type of case and the statute of limitations for each state. For instance, some states restrict the time a person has to take legal action to two years from the date of their diagnosis or death of a loved one due to mesothelioma. A knowledgeable attorney can ensure that the victim isn't left behind by investigating and preparing a claim as early as they are able to.

Mesothelioma cases are complex and require a thorough investigation. A lawyer will conduct interviews and depositions at the patient's home or in a hospital. This allows them to create a strong legal case. Mesothelioma lawyers will visit companies that have worked with asbestos in order to gather evidence. This involves reviewing records of workers as well as interviews with coworkers and other experts, as well as reviewing documents of the company as well as other evidence that could aid the client's case.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is national is familiar with the laws in a variety of states and have a nationwide presence for local victims. This can be beneficial because it gives victims more options when submitting claims. National law firms are more likely to have a greater database of defendants.
